Selecting the Right Outside Paint Color Styles



When selecting exterior paint colors for your home, consider the total aesthetic you want to accomplish and exactly how the colors will certainly match your environments. Begin by analyzing the design of your residence. For typical homes, traditional shades like whites, lotions, or neutrals can boost their beauty. If you have a modern-day home, vibrant and different shades might be more fitting.

Have a look at the surrounding atmosphere. Nature-inspired hues like greens or browns can assist your home assimilate with the landscape, while brighter colors can make it attract attention. Keep in mind that darker shades can make a house appear smaller sized, while lighter colors can produce a feeling of space.

Furthermore, think about the building attributes you wish to emphasize. Utilizing paint straight line for trim can highlight one-of-a-kind details. Do not neglect to evaluate paint examples on your home's outside to see how they search in different lighting problems before making your final decision.

Prepping Your Surfaces for Painting



To make certain a smooth and long-lasting paint job, effectively preparing your surface areas is essential. Begin by thoroughly cleaning up the exterior of your home. Make use of a pressure washer or a combination of soap and water to get rid of dust, gunk, and any kind of peeling off paint. Permit the surface areas to dry totally before going on to the next action.

Next, examine the exterior for any kind of fractures, holes, or damaged areas. Load these blemishes with a top notch filler or caulk to produce a smooth surface for painting. Sand down harsh areas and feather out any kind of edges to avoid a noticeable appearance difference after paint.



After fixing and fining sand, it's vital to prime your surfaces prior to applying the paint. Primer helps the paint adhere far better and gives an uniform surface area for a specialist surface. Choose a guide that appropriates for your surface type, whether it's timber, metal, or stonework.

Applying Exterior Paint Like a Pro



For a professional coating when repainting the outside of your home, grasping the strategy of using paint is essential. Beginning by utilizing high-quality brushes or rollers suitable for the kind of outside paint you've selected. When using the paint, operate in little areas to make certain also insurance coverage and avoid the paint from drying too promptly.

Begin at the top of your house and function your means down, complying with the natural circulation of the home siding.
